KesionCMS-自定义SQL函数标签实现连续滚动文章
来自站长百科
导航:返回上一页
连续滚动文章
- 查询语句:select TOP 20 ID,Title from KS_Article where rolls=1 order by id desc
显示前20条滚动文章
- 循环体:
<DIV id=demo onmouseover=ii=1 style="OVERFLOW: hidden; HEIGHT: 180px" onmouseout=ii=0> <DIV id=demo1> <table width="100%" border="0" cellspacing="0" cellpadding="3"> [loop=20] <tr> <td><a href="{$Field(ID,GetInfoUrl,1,1)}">{$Field(Title,Text,0,,0,)}</a></td> </tr> [/loop] </table> </DIV> <DIV id=demo2> <SCRIPT> var ii=0;t=demo.scrollTop demo2.innerHTML=demo1.innerHTML function qswhMarquee(){ if (ii==1)return if(demo2.offsetTop-demo.scrollTop<=0) demo.scrollTop-=demo1.offsetHeight else demo.scrollTop++ } setInterval(qswhMarquee,60) </SCRIPT></DIV>
最后在模板中调用如{SQL_连续滚动文章()}